Tao Cottage is situated in the old part of Boscastle, uphill from the harbour and shops. The cottage is light and spacious with 4 bedrooms, a bathroom, separate toilet, living room and breakfast room/kitchen. At the rear of the property is a patio, with garden furniture and barbecue and a steeply terraced garden leading down to the valley. The spectacular cliffs surrounding Boscastle can be reached in a few minutes by walking uphill from the cottage. The beautiful beaches of Daymar Bay, Polzeath, Trebarwith Strand and Widemouth are within easy driving distance.
